Alterations
Before You Apply
It is encouraged that you contact the Zoning & Planning Department while planning your project to confirm compliance with basic zoning requirements and to discuss the review and approval process.
Exterior Alterations
Review by the Building Board is required for work where a minor exterior change(s) does not extend an existing building beyond its current footprint. Examples of exterior alterations include window or exterior door replacements, deck replacement, siding or exterior material changes, new architectural features, adding/modifying shutters, trim, railings, new exterior lighting, etc.
The Board meets twice per month (1st and 3rd Tuesday) at 5:30 p.m. To get placed on agenda, all materials must be submitted digitally to the Zoning and Planning Administrator at least 2 weeks in advance of the meeting. Once deemed complete by the Zoning and Planning Administrator, physical copies must be provided at least one week before the meeting.
The submittal requirements for an exterior alteration are listed below. A more comprehensive list of Building Alteration requirements may be found at the hyperlink.
Interior Alterations
A building permit and relevant additional permits must be filed for interior work including, but not limited to kitchen, bathroom and lower-level remodels/updates, and room size changes. To get more specific, the following type of work requires a permit (again, not comprehensive):
- Foundation repair
- Removing, adding, or modifying interior walls
- Structural beam or column installation/removal
- Modifying stairways
- Interior demolition
- Attic, basement, or garage conversions to habitable space
- Egress improvements
- New or relocated plumbing fixtures
- HVAC installation or replacement
- Ductwork changes
- New electrical circuits, panel upgrades, rewiring
- Installing or relocating gas piping
Required Forms
Depending on the scope of your project, electrical, plumbing, and/or HVAC permits may be needed in addition to a building permit. Please submit all permits as necessary.
- Building Board Worksheet (PDF) - Includes $50 Building Board fee
- Building Permit Form (PDF)
- Electrical Permit Form (PDF) - Only if electrical work will be completed.
- Plumbing Permit Form (PDF) - Only if plumbing work will be completed.
- HVAC Permit Form (PDF) - Only if HVAC work will be completed.
- Release and Indemnification Form (PDF) - Only if resident doing work on their own.
- Building Permit Addendum (PDF) - Only if exterior alteration(s) are proposed
Requirements for exterior alteration(s)
- Building Plans
- Scaled elevations from all sides, noting all exterior materials, lighting, and colors - required only for exterior alterations
- Cut sheets of windows, doors, siding, decking, etc. - required for exterior alterations
- Material and color samples must be brought to the Building Board meeting - required only for exterior alterations
- Interior floor plans for impacted areas
*Important* - 14 hard copies of the plans listed above must be provided on ledger-sized paper (11"x18") following review of plans digitally by the Zoning & Planning Administrator.
Inspections
The following inspections can be anticipated for an alteration project:
- Rough framing
- Insulation
- Final
For a next business day inspection, it must be scheduled by 4:00 p.m. the day prior.
